It’s time to cosy up this winter… ‘Definitely one to curl up with this winter’ NetGalley Reviewer‘Utterly enchanting, I already want to return to the Log Fire Cabin for yet another book’ GoodReads Reviewer‘I loved every bit of this book, an absolutely perfect feel-good Christmas read.’ GoodReads Reviewer When Roxy proposes to her boyfriend Jackson in a moment of madness on live TV, she’s mortified when he rejects her. To escape the embarrassment, she takes a job working as baking assistant at the idyllic Log Fire Cabin. Roxy hopes the new job will take her mind off Jackson, because to her eternal annoyance, she hasn’t been able to stop thinking about him… But when Jackson turns up at the cabin unexpectedly, things begin to go wrong. With a sprinkle of snow, the help of new friends and more than a couple of mince pies, can Roxy heal her heart in time for Christmas?
